Santa Monica Time Now: Current Local Time & Info

Santa Monica time is currently Pacific Daylight Time, matching the precise clock on every synchronized device in the region. This coastal city operates on a strict UTC-7 schedule during daylight saving months, aligning with the broader Los Angeles metropolitan time zone. For anyone planning a visit or coordinating a call, understanding this offset is the first step to seamless scheduling.

The Mechanics of Santa Monica Time

Unlike global locations that observe complex, irregular time zones, Santa Monica adheres to a straightforward system. The implementation of Daylight Saving Time means clocks spring forward in March and fall back in November. During the summer months, the designation changes to Pacific Daylight Time (PDT), shifting the city one hour ahead of standard time. This bi-annual adjustment ensures maximum daylight utilization and is a key detail for travelers to remember.
